Transaction 384504489bafc21d3706fe4aefed517e6baf7c4a3f81787e33bc2520ca31d51c

1 Input
2 Outputs
  • 384504489bafc21d3706fe4aefed517e6baf7c4a3f81787e33bc2520ca31d51c:0
  • value  84852041
    address  3CvmcsmtBoqcvB2JAwyY3dXg3Zp2QYR47L
  • 384504489bafc21d3706fe4aefed517e6baf7c4a3f81787e33bc2520ca31d51c:1
  • value  3882240
    address  34TGybdPTb4RihvGTDT21PBZheUEHqjPwz